Bloom Culture helps couples DIY their wedding flowers with confidence — even if you’ve never arranged flowers before. We ship wholesale flowers to your door and provide a full plan that shows you what to order, how much you need, and how to put everything together. You’ll know exactly how many stems go into each bouquet, centerpiece, boutonniere — and how to assemble them step-by-step. Choose one of our DIY flower kits or get a custom plan based on your colors, style, and budget.

The flowers (on our order) came in large boxes, but they were not labeled, so it took a minute to get the flowers both identified and properly set up. To be fair we were warned about the process, but not about the length of time due to our inexperience. As a note, it took my fiancé 5 hours to process the flowers when first receiving them. I also did not have any updates from them from the time I ordered till they were being shipped. They were beyond more affordable compared to other florists, and the flowers arrived alive and in good spirits. We were able to keep the flowers alive for over four days!! Many of the flowers that we chose did not have specific instructions, so we had to follow the general reference for the flowers and hope for the best. Additionally, some of the flowers that we wanted were not in stock, and they were replaced for us with substitutes but were not notified until we had all of the flowers already delivered to us. Also, as a note, bloom culture uses third party sellers for their flowers, so the quality may vary depending on location. Our flowers were in good condition, and the company we had clearly took good care of the flowers prior to delivering them to us. Would we do it again? Probably not, but it made for good laughs and bonding time and we have stories to tell from it!
